Hi friends. I bought Iphone X. In software update it shows me that there is new update that fix some issues but it wont allow me to do it because i am on my celluar network. Currently i am away i wont have access to my home Wifi for some time now. I read it wont run even if my cell network plan is very high. Is it of extreme importance to do that update or it can wait for a while, couple of months maybe. Or shall i search for wifi connection to do it right away :)

Personally, I would search for a free WiFi site and do the update. It contains some security things that you might need. On the other hand, if that is really difficult to do, you will have to wait.

You can turn off Notifications of updates, and also, disable the automatic download (of OS updates), feature. Then you can update, or check for updates, on your schedule.
